How to Install and Uninstall qdirstat Package on Debian 10 (Buster)

Last updated: May 20,2024

1. Install "qdirstat" package

This guide let you learn how to install qdirstat on Debian 10 (Buster)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install qdirstat

2. Uninstall "qdirstat" package

Please follow the steps below to uninstall qdirstat on Debian 10 (Buster):

$ sudo apt remove qdirstat $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
